Electrical problem
1999 Oldsmobile Cutlass

Car starts fine every time. Every few starts, dash gauges all go high, then to zero and trip odometer resets. At Autozone, they connected to the battery and said that the alternator was good but the batter showed to "check connection" as if it were open or maybe a temp deead short. This is an electrical issues. Any idea what?

at this point you need to check all connections from battery to alternator to starter, for corrosion, loose connections etc. it is easy to miss corrosion if it is inside the cable so look really good
